WebIn 1995, New Jersey began moving Medicaid beneficiaries from a traditional fee-for-service health coverage program, where providers bill Medicaid directly, to managed care. Under managed care, beneficiaries enroll in a health plan or managed care organization (MCO) which coordinates their members' healthcare and offers special services in addition to … Web16 okt. 2015 · 1915 Waiver Toolkit; CHIP SPA Toolkit; Medicaid SPA Toolkit; Medicaid and CHIP Eligibility & Enrollment Webinars; CMCS Medicaid and CHIP All State Calls. 2024 All State Calls; ... Web7 mei 2024 · By Liora Engel-Smith. North Carolina’s Medicaid program is shifting roughly two-thirds of its enrollees into managed care this summer, starting on July 1. In the process, thousands of enrollees — some of whom have never had to choose health insurance or a network — were thrust into a process that many have found difficult and confusing. WebAn HCBS waiver is an extra set of Health First Colorado (Colorado's Medicaid program) benefits that you could qualify for in certain cases. These benefits can help you remain in your home and community. HCBS Waivers have extra program rules and some programs may have waitlists.
